CeeDee Lamb struggles to get going in season opener

by Diego Sandoval | Cowboys Correspondent | Mon, Sep 12th 12:20am EDT

CeeDee Lamb hauled in just two of his 11 targets for 29 receiving yards in Sunday's 19-3 loss to the Buccaneers.

Fantasy Impact:

Lamb, along with the rest of the Dallas offense, could not find a way to produce during Sunday Night Football, but it shouldn't be entirely attributed to him. The wideout led the team with 11 targets, but many of them were either uncatchable or desperation heaves by a pressured Dak Prescott. Now, it is reported that Prescott is out for at least several weeks, leaving Cooper Rush as the quarterback in Dallas. This greatly caps Lamb's upside, so he should be considered a low-end WR1 at best, leaning a bit toward the WR2 conversation.
